My changes to patch 01 introduced a sed s,...,\n,  command, which is of
course not portable.  It led to bogus summary output on stdout with
Solaris sed and others, as documented by POSIX.

    parallel-tests: Fix summary output.
    
    * lib/am/check.am (am__text_box): Fix unportable sed script,
    replacing `\n' in the right hand side of an `s' command with
    a literal newline.  Kudos to Bruno Haible for the newline idea.
    * tests/parallel-tests.test: Update test to expose this.
